美文网首页
Api管家系列(二):编辑和继承Class

Api管家系列(二):编辑和继承Class

作者: leonxliu | 来源:发表于2019-04-26 13:44 被阅读0次

    上篇写了个大概,今天我详细说一下参数的编辑,废话不多说

    先打开一个项目,我要特别说一下设置里的“默认参数设置

    打开默认参数设置,设置完成后会在新建接口的时候自动填入定义好的参数

    注意:只对新建的接口有用,对之前的接口和复制的接口无效

    红色圈出的tab可以设置请求头,返回头和返回状态

    我这里设置一下请求头和返回状态,保存

    设置请求头 设置返回状态

    接下来开始新建接口

    点击新增接口

    默认参数已经填入了

    默认参数已经被填入

    填入详细信息,保存

    输入接口基本信息

    新建接口时并没有填写请求参数和返回参数,所以界面上会提示继续完善

    没有填写请求参数和返回参数

    点击编辑或请求Class说明旁边的按钮,可以回到编辑界面,请求和返回Class就出现了,特别介绍下设置父Class,可以大大减少将来维护接口文档和修改代码的工作量

    Class编辑

    点击设置父Class,会弹出Class设置的页面,圈出的“是否是内部Class”的选项表示是否有其它接口会用到这个Class,不勾就会显示在选择外部Class的列表中

    父Class编辑

    点击“选择外部Class”,出现外部Class的列表,可以很方便的引用

    注意1:虽然外部Class使用方便并且可以到处引用,但还是强烈建议减少使用外部Class如果外部Class太多,这个列表会很长,找起来比较麻烦

    注意2:这里删除按钮必须是引用计数为0才会出现,应该是出于防止误删的考虑吧

    点击引用按钮

    选择其中一个来使用,然后直接保存 

    点击引用后,参数自动填入

    这样父Class就设置好了,回到第一个参数编辑的页面,可以看到从父Class继承的参数已经填好,并且在这个页面是不能修改的。

    注意1:当父Class被修改,这里的继承的参数也会自动被修改,维护就方便了很多

    注意2:角上的减号可以直接删除自己的父Class,父Class的参数也会被一起删除

    保存一下我们的接口,这里有个提示,其实是因为返回Class并没有设置,设置完了就不会有提示了

    返回Class并没有设置

    这里有我最终生成的文档

    圈出5个Class

    生成-->生成代码-->Java-->Gson

    生成的代码

    一下就写好5个Class, 还带注释

    好了,搞接口去了,强烈要求请求返回都能生成,牛逼的程序员都应该是只搞逻辑的,琐事就应该是自动生成的

    下次更新会介绍API管家的测试功能

    相关文章

      网友评论

          本文标题:Api管家系列(二):编辑和继承Class

          本文链接:https://www.haomeiwen.com/subject/gbpfnqtx.html